The Theme, Hosts, and Everything Else You Need to Know About the 2024 Met Gala

- Advertisement -

The Met Gala will celebrate the Costume Institute’s 2024 exhibition, ‘Sleeping Beauty: Reawakening Fashion’, on May 6tt. The exhibition features 250 historically significant pieces, considered’sleeping beauties’, and original designs from designers like Elsa Schiaparelli, Christian Dior, Yves Saint Laurent, and Hubert de Givenchy. Guests will dress to the theme of ‘The Garden of Time’, inspired by the J.G. Ballard short story.

Below, everything you need to know about the 2024 Met Gala.

What even is the Met Gala?

Every year, The Metropolitan Museum of Art’s Costume Institute hosts the Met Gala, a charity event that raises a substantial amount of money (vis ticket sales) and usually opens the museum’s yearly fashion show. It attracts the biggest A-list names who dress according to a set theme of that year.

When is the Met Gala scheduled for 2024?

The 2024 Met Gala is scheduled for May 6 at The Metropolitan Museum of Art and will honor the Costume Institute’s exhibition, “Sleeping Beauties: Reawakening Fashion.”

The Met Gala 2024 theme?

The Costume Institute’s exhibition, “Sleeping Beauties: Reawakening Fashion,” will be featured at the 2024 Met Gala, and will include approximately 250 rare artifacts from its permanent collection. The display covers more than 400 years of fashion history and features designs by Schiaparelli, Dior, Givenchy, and others. Some delicate clothes will be showcased using video animation, light projection, AI, CGI, and other sensory stimulation. The exhibition will be organized across three major “zones”: land, sea, and sky, paying homage to nature and the emotive poetics of fashion.

Who is hosting the Met Gala 2024?

The 2024 Met Gala will be hosted by Zendaya, Jennifer Lopez, Bad Bunny, and Chris Hemsworth, following last year’s star-studded group including Penélope Cruz, Michaela Coel, Roger Federer, Dua Lipa, and Anna Wintour.

This years Met Gala dress code?

The 2024 Met Gala dress code is “The Garden of Time,” inspired by J.G. Ballard’s 1962 short story. The story centers on Count Axel and his wife, the Countess, who have a perfect life filled with beauty, art, and leisure. A home with a balcony overlooking a garden of crystalline flowers is featured in the novel; this mansion represents modern contemporary society and the psychological ramifications of social, technical, or environmental advancements. The crowd storms the villa, where a neglected garden has a statue of the Count and his Countess entwined in belladonna plants. The Count needs to remove a time-reversing flower from his garden in order to bring peace back.

The gala theme embraces the “garden” element of the plot and highlights transient beauty while striking a balance between art, relaxation, and beauty via sad flowers. Despite its diverse interpretation, floral and botanical looks are expected to grace the red carpet.

But what really happens at the Met Gala?

The event is a secret, requiring guests to follow a no-phone and social media policy. But according to Vogue, it also includes a high profiled performance with guests exploring the exhibition before dinner.

Where is the Met Gala held?

The Metropolitan Museum of Art hosts the Met Gala annually on the first Monday in May in New York City, with attendees typically staying in nearby hotels and gathering at celebrity hotspots.

Who is invited to the Met Gala?

The guest list is kept secret until the evening before the event, but attracts around 600 attendees.

How to the Met Gala 2024?

The 2024 Met Gala will be streamed live on Vogue.com and various digital platforms, including Instagram, Facebook, and Twitter.
